Output 90ecb994d41c8c38e15ab1a6ae4cc93f6abdbfdfd4586b54fbd6806328bc53d0:1

value
70052
script pubkey
OP_0 OP_PUSHBYTES_20 988fa352f787278c99b9befc9f48f312b5093871
address
bc1qnz86x5hhsuncexdehm7f7j8nz26sjwr3jj5v4s
transaction
90ecb994d41c8c38e15ab1a6ae4cc93f6abdbfdfd4586b54fbd6806328bc53d0
confirmations
152363
spent
true